How to Use in the Classroom
- Warm-up activity: Start class with a 5-minute word search to activate prior knowledge
- Early finisher task: Students who complete assignments early can play independently
- Vocabulary review: Use before a quiz to help students review key terms
- Station rotation: Add as a literacy or vocabulary station in centers
- Homework: Share the link for at-home vocabulary practice

What geography topics do these words cover?
The words span landforms (peninsula, canyon, delta), map skills (latitude, longitude, meridian), climate (tropical, monsoon, tundra), and earth processes (tectonic, volcanic, erosion).
